#974d3f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#974d3f is composed of 59.2% red, 30.2%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 49% magenta, 58.3%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 9.5 degrees, a saturation of 41.1% and a lightness of 42%. #974d3f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9a7e with #2f0000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#974d3f color description : Dark moderate red.

#974d3f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#974d3f has RGB values of R:151, G:77, B:63 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.49, Y:0.58,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 9915711.

Shades and Tints of #974d3f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0605 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#974d3f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e6968 is the less saturated color, while #d12605 is the most saturated one.
